LSSAA kicked off on
Tuesday September 18 with two games in Junior Girls Soccer. The St
Clair Colts shut out SCITS in a close 1 - 0 game with Megan Alderman scoring
for the Colt and Breanne Newton earning the shut out in net. St.
Christopher also shut out NLSS by a score of 1 - 0 on a goal scored by
A. Petitfrere.
In Junior Boys soccer
action SCITS dominated and took a 5 - 0 win over St. Clair. Xander
Burley and Cooper Muxlow each scored two goal and a single by Nick Vail.
Cole Anderson earned the shutout in net.
Junior Girls Basketball
took to the courts on Tuesday with St. Clair taking a 47 - 20 win over LCCVI
in Petrolia. Top point getters for St. Clair were Ashley Moore with 13
and 11 for Bailey McAuley. For LCCVI Sophie Barnes, Josalyn
DeVlugt and Katie Proctor each score 4 points each. In other action
St. Christopher defeated SCITS with a final score of 60 - 38.
St. Francois-Xavier won
their first game in Junior Boys Volleyball over Northern taking two games
with final scores 25 - 16 and 25 - 13. Northern took 1
game 25 - 20. Player of the match for St. Francois-Xavier was Arthur
Esengi and Geoff Spielman for Northern.
In Senior Boys action St.
Francois-Xavier came out on top with 2 wins 25 - 21, 25 - 23 over Northern
who took a single match 25 - 18. James Rozt earned player of the match
for St. Francois-Exavier and Quinn Dowding for Northern.
